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,333,300,145
Lastest Block:
1,977,211
Utxos:
1,984,787
Nodes:
320
OmniXEP Contracts:
274
Block details
[STAKE]
15/03/2021 03:13:36 UTC
Txid
d03563320721284c150f46264f724dbceec940bfa83cb96c9e385bccda00c6b3
Block
84,758
Block hash
4b689057a86aac16678d0983b40f6ffd6b8c7257d187f3ca5e1f8198f0d43e53
Stake amount
160.23231726 XEP
Sender
ep1qrwrjwznqpg6a8l8w0tqkjp48qu2sav46ulkspx
Recipient
ep1qrwrjwznqpg6a8l8w0tqkjp48qu2sav46ulkspx
(3,190,425.36335908 XEP)